Find Cheap European Flights
Find Cheap European Flights

Traveling within Europe with an airplane has become popular as it has become inexpensive. Today, there are many discount airlines that focus solely on selling cheap European flights. If traveling from one European country to another and if planned accordingly, traveling from one European city to another with an airplane can be cheaper than taking a train or bus.

Instructions

Things You'll Need:

  • time
  • internet
  • credit/debit card
  • a plan
  1. Step 1

    Research. As soon as you know your travel dates start researching the multiply discount European airlines for the cheapest flight. The airline company you choose to fly depends on whether you are flying, for example, from Western to Eastern Europe, or just within Western Europe. For example, Ryanair offers primarily flights to and from the UK while Wizzair offers primarily flights to and from Eastern Europe. Cheap European flights are offered by discount airlines such as Easyjet, SkyEurope and Germanwings to name a few (check out Resources, below article, for a more complete list of cheap European airlines).

  2. Step 2

    Timing. The key to getting cheap European flights is to reserve your ticket in advance. The earlier you book the cheaper your ticket will be. A lot of cheap European flights start the price at 0.01 cents (excluding tax, which can be around 30 euros). If you wait even a month before your flight (depending on the season and destination) a 0.01 cent flight can go up to more than 100 euros (excluding tax).
    It pays to book cheap European flights as early as possible.

  3. Step 3

    Season. Because travel has become cheaper within Europe more and more Europeans are traveling within Europe by taking advantage of the cheap European flights. When planning a trip to Europe and within Europe make sure you research if you are going to be traveling during any long weekend holidays or festivals. Chances are if there is a long weekend holiday or festival in your destination cheap flights are going to book up fast. Europeans take advantage of the cheap flights and therefore book months in advance, buying off most of the cheaper flights. If you do your research and book months ahead you are guaranteed cheaper European flights.

  4. Step 4

    Payment. Be prepared to reserve and pay for your cheap European flight online with a credit/debit card. Make sure to read the fine print as many cheap European flights are non-refundable, but can be exchangeable for a fee. Also keep in mind that most cheap European airlines have a strict luggage limit, so make sure you are not carrying more than you are allowed to unless you are willing to pay the fees.
